Output 21c66de0a847ee4612dffb3ec893a07f79497b38cf469265293e9f063625d28a:1

value
19615926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ce819f3babbcdb03cab8b321193bc82eaa378452 OP_EQUALVERIFY OP_CHECKSIG
address
1KpuUp5wTuWNAXWKnhdLFZ5SHNGYaS48zf
transaction
21c66de0a847ee4612dffb3ec893a07f79497b38cf469265293e9f063625d28a
spent
true